On solving the KdV-Burger's equation and the Wu-Zhang equations using the modified variational iteration method

Abstract:
By using the modified variational iteration method (MVIM), the Solutions of the (2+1)-dimensional Korteweg - de Vries Burger's equation and the (2+1)-dimensional Wu-Zhang equations are exactly obtained. The method is powerful and easy to use as an analytic tool for the nonlinear problems. The present study highlights efficiency of the method.
